About

Northolt South is a residential neighbourhood in the London Borough of Ealing, characterised by its suburban housing and green spaces. The area is primarily made up of interwar and post-war semi-detached and terraced houses, with local shopping parades serving the community's daily needs.

A notable feature is the presence of the RAF Northolt station, a working Royal Air Force base with a long history, which shares its name with the area. The nearby Northala Fields, with its distinctive artificial hills created from recycled construction materials, provides open space for recreation and walking.

Area overview

On average Northolt South has very high de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 78 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 37.4%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Northolt South is £66,416 per year. There are 2 schools in Northolt South: 1 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). On average most houses in area has low public transport connectivity. Northolt South is home to around 9,308 people, with a population density of about 5,622.8 per km2.

Property prices in Northolt South

Based on 37 recent sales, the median property price is £280,000 in Northolt South area, with individual transactions ranging from £94,500 up to £642,500.
